Diagnostic Medical Sonography/Sonographer and Ultrasound Technician Schools in Alaska
8 students earned Diagnostic Medical Sonography/Sonographer and Ultrasound Technician degrees in Alaska in the 2022-2023 year.

Jobs for Diagnostic Medical Sonography/Sonographer and Ultrasound Technician Grads in Alaska
In this state, there are 140 people employed in jobs related to a diagnostic medical sonography/sonographer and ultrasound technician degree, compared to 270,610 nationwide.
Wages for Diagnostic Medical Sonography/Sonographer and Ultrasound Technician Jobs in Alaska
A typical salary for a diagnostic medical sonography/sonographer and ultrasound technician grad in the state is $64,880, compared to a typical salary of $73,860 nationwide.
Diagnostic Medical Sonography/Sonographer and Ultrasound Technician Careers in AK
Some of the careers diagnostic medical sonography/sonographer and ultrasound technician majors go into include:
Job Title | AK Job Growth | AK Median Salary |
---|---|---|
Diagnostic Medical Sonographers | 25% | $94,130 |
Health Specialties Professors | 17% | $71,400 |
